Gunther, WWE’s “Ring General,” suffered a devastating facial injury at SummerSlam Night One and has been ruled out of action indefinitely. During his title defense against CM Punk, the veteran superstar was tripped onto the Spanish announce table, crashing face‑first and emerging bleeding.

On Monday Night Raw, Michael Cole revealed that Gunther incurred a septal hematoma and orbital blowout fracture as a result. The announcement served both as storyline and confirmation of a real injury requiring serious medical care.

WWE followed up with an official statement emphasizing that the injury would sideline Gunther for an unknown duration. The commentary framed it as a way to transition his character off‑screen while he recovers. It also provided an explanation for why CM Punk’s victory and subsequent loss of the title to Seth Rollins’ surprise Money in the Bank cash‑in were necessary.

Gunther’s absence reshapes WWE’s summer arc

This injury marks a major shift in WWE’s SummerSlam fallout. Punk’s victory over Gunther was celebrated as a comeback moment, but his reign was immediately ended when Seth Rollins sprang a shock cash‑in. That twist overshadowed both Gunther’s loss and Punk’s brief title moment, propelling Rollins to the top of the card.

Gunther’s injury was reportedly booked to cover a legitimate nose issue he had been dealing with prior to SummerSlam. Reports suggest backstage footage and storyline angles were crafted around the injury, culminating in a face‑shattering finish and an on‑air medical diagnosis. His absence leaves a title void and opens up new opportunities for rising stars in WWE’s hierarchy.

Fans and analysts now face a waiting game, watching for updates on Gunther’s health and possible return. There’s no official timeline yet only that he’s sidelined “indefinitely.” Meanwhile WWE must pivot quickly.
